200 Pensioners Die Over Starvation In Imo

Published

on

Following the inability of
the Imo State Government to pay pension as at when due, about 200 retired civil servants have died through starvation and inability to afford medications.
Chairman, Association of Retired Permanent Secretaries of Imo State, Chief Hyacinth Onyekwere, made the assertion, while briefing newsmen in Owerri, the Imo State capital.
Onyekwere, said between November 2011 till date, 12 retired permanent secretaries have died as a result of non-payment of pension to enable them feed and buy their medications.
